Be very careful and stay clear of any type of attorney who mentions that he will "ensure" any certain result. I have actually become aware of some attorneys that make such bold guarantees to persuade customers to employ them. There are a number of problems with this method of making "guarantees" on the end results of criminal situations. First, it is impossible to "assure" what the end result will be because there are a lot of variables. The lawyer must have the ability to evaluate the advantages of the charges brought versus you by reviewing the details and/or grievance filed by the People. Any kind of police records or interrogation transcripts can assist in the attorney s analysis of a possible cause determination, any possible witnesses or incriminating declarations offered. Any kind of duplicates of Appeal previous interactions with the claimed victim( s) may help to establish potential defenses or poke openings in the prosecution s instance. If you have in your ownership, rap sheets or information connecting to prior criminal sentences is exceptionally vital to offer. And of course, if you have a reputable and authorized alibi, make sure to bring any and all proof to the attorney for extensive analysis.
